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Shepreth to Silverdale start from as little as £20.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Shepreth to Silverdale start from £73.70 one way, or £150.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Shepreth to Silverdale are available for £146.90 one way, or £413.40 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Services

Though Shepreth station lacks a formal ticket office, ticket machines are conveniently available for all your ticketing needs, including online ticket collection. These machines are also equipped to provide disc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ders, ensuring accessibility for all travelers. Departure screens and announcement systems keep passengers informed, while help points are strategically placed on platforms for additional assistance when needed.

Accessibility is a key focus at Shepreth, with step-free access provided to both platforms through separate entrances. However, note that further assistance might be required for access between trains and platforms. If needed, staff-operated ramps are available, and a mobile assistance team is on hand to ensure seamless boarding. For those planning a trip, it's wise to arrive about 20 minutes before the train's departure.

Travel Connections

Shepreth station offers direct train connections to a variety of popular destinations. Frequent services run to bustling city centers such as Cambridge and London Kings Cross, making it an ideal boarding point for both local and long-distance travelers. Other popular routes include journeys to Royston, Letchworth Garden City, and Stevenage.

Onward travel from Shepreth station is well-supported with local bus services and taxis, ensuring an easy transition from train to other modes of transport. For updated bus schedules and rail replacement service details, travelers can consult the station's Onward Travel Information Map. Facilities and Accessibility at Silverdale Station

While Silverdale Train Station may not boast a wide array of facilities, it covers the essentials to ensure a comfortable journey for all. The station is equipped with ticket machines from which you can collect pre-purchased tickets. Additionally, an induction loop system is in place for those who may benefit from hearing assistance. For those in need of purchasing or validating smartcards, Silverdale is ready to assist, although it lacks validators for smartcards.

Accessibility at the station is quite comprehensive, with step-free options available, although travelers should be aware that assistance from staff is not offered. Helpful ramps are available to improve access on and off platforms, and there's a seating area for those waiting for their train. While there are no waiting rooms or accessible toilets available, the station provides bicycle storage with eight dedicated spaces on Platform 1.

Onward Travel Connections from Silverdale

Connectivity from Silverdale is enhanced with a range of travel options. For those needing alternatives due to train disruptions, a rail replacement service operates from bus stops on Red Bridge Lane. Although taxis aren't readily available on-site, they can be booked online for hassle-free travel, and Northern Railway offers a handy taxi service found at northernrailway.co.uk/tickets/cab4you. Local buses also connect Silverdale to nearby towns and attractions, promising easy transitions between different modes of transportation.
